از سیام جولای ۲۰۱۵ که ویتالیک بوترین جوان ۲۳ سالهی روسی، رسماً پلتفرم اتریوم را بهمنظور اجرای برنامههای غیرمتمرکز معرفی کرد، نگاه جدیدی به کاربرد بلاک چینهای عمومی به وجود آمد. پیش از آن، معروفترین بلاک چین، بلاک چین بیت کوین بود که باهدف یک سیستم پرداخت جهانی همتا به همتا و غیرمتمرکز ایجادشده بود.
بهتدریج که برنامههای کاربردی بر روی پلتفرم اتریوم توسعه یافتند، چالش مقیاسپذیری مطرح شد و این مشکلی بود که نه تنها اتریوم بلکه تمامی ارزهای دیجیتال با آن دستوپنجه نرم میکردند، مقیاسپذیری ارزهای دیجیتال یا به عبارتی افزایش تعداد تراکنشها در ثانیه (TPS) در حال حاضر نرخ پایینی برای کاربردهای بینالمللی نظیر ویزا و مستر کارت دارد. مقیاسپذیری تابعی از سه پارامتر TPS، تمرکززدایی و امنیت است.
اتریوم برای حل مشکل مقیاسپذیری چندین راهکار پیش گرفت که از جملهی آنها میتوان به کسپر، پلاسما و شاردینگ اشاره کرد. برای حل مشکل مقیاسپذیری پلتفرمهای بسیاری به رقابت با اتریوم پرداختند.
دفینیتی(Dfinity) موفق به جذب سرمایهی بیش از ۱۶۷ میلیون دلار شد و در حقیقت یک کپی از اتریوم بوده که با برند پرزرق و برقی منتشرشده است. Dfinity یک مدل ابری غیرمتمرکز ارائه میدهد و خود را شبیه به اتریوم البته با محدودیتهای کمتری دانسته که ظرفیتهای نامحدودی دارد.
کاردانو یک پلتفرم مبتنی بر بلاک چین است که مانند اتریوم قابلیت ایجاد و اجرای قراردادهای هوشمند را دارد. با این تفاوت که کاردانو مقیاسپذیرتر بوده و امنیت را از طریق معماری لایهای فراهم میکند. کاردانو از اتریوم و نئو بالغتر است. با توجه به ریشهی آکادمیکش به نسبت EOS رسمیتر بوده و بهعنوان بلاک چین نسل دوم از آن یاد میشود.
بیشتر بخوانید: تمام تفاوتهای اتریوم و نئو
ایاس(EOS) بهمنظور تبدیلشدن به یک سیستمعامل غیرمتمرکز برای پوشش انبوهی از برنامههای غیرمتمرکز، توسعه یافت. EOS میخواهد کارمزد تراکنشها را برای همیشه حذف کند و مدعی است که پلتفرمش خواهد توانست میلیونها تراکنش را در ثانیه انجام دهد.
و حالا هارمونی ادعا میکند یک زیرساخت متنباز برای اجماع ساخته است که از ۱۰ میلیارد کاربر پشتیبانی میکند. در این مقاله به معرفی اجمالی پلتفرم هارمونی میپردازیم.
پلتفرم هارمونی
غیره را داشتهاند گرد هم آمده و به دنبال راهحلی برای مقیاسپذیری میباشند.
این تیم سرمایهی اولیه (seed money) دریافت کرده و ایدههای جدیدی برای ایجاد مقیاسپذیری دارد. پروتکل هارمونی برای ایجاد یک بازار آزاد در مقیاس گوگل برای اقتصاد غیرمتمرکز است.
هارمونی معتقد است مقیاسپذیری به بهینهسازی در تمام لایههای یک شبکه نیاز دارد.
پروتکل اجماع هارمونی (Harmony Consensus Protocol)
پروتکل اجماع هارمونی از شاردینگ دستورالعملهای چند گامی برای موازیسازی پردازش فرآیندها استفاده میکند. این کار به ما کمک میکند تأخیر ارتباطات (Latency) را کنترل کنیم و توان عملیاتی شبکه (throughput) را با بزرگتر شدن شبکه، حفظ کنیم.
سیستم
تیم هارمونی در حال طراحی یک هسته عملیاتی برای اجرای پروتکلش میباشد که کارایی CPU و امنیت را افزایش میدهد. این هسته همچنین به نودهای بیشتری امکان شرکت در اجماع را داده و شبکهی غیرمتمرکزتری را ایجاد میکند.
شبکه
هارمونی از تکنیکهای مهندسی شبکه برای انتشار پیام (message propagation) به شکل هوشمندانهتر و تشکیل سریعتر اجماع استفاده کرده است. هارمونی میگوید درک توپولوژی شبکه به ایجاد یک پروتکل همزمان کمک میکند.
زیرساخت هارمونی متنباز است که به علت توان عملیات بالا، تأخیر کم و هزینهی ناچیز امروزه بهعنوان یک پلتفرم اجماع انقلابی در شبکههای غیرمتمرکز محسوب میشود.
ویژگیهای پلتفرم هارمونی
زیرساخت متنباز برای دادههای جهان
مقیاس جهانی برای پلتفرم بازار
پیدایش اقتصادهای غیرمتمرکز و قابلاعتماد
غیرمتمرکزسازی مقیاسپذیر
هدف فراهم کردن غیرمتمرکزسازی و مقیاسپذیری با حفظ امنیت میباشد. فناوری بلاک چین به ما قول داده بود تا بستر غیرمتمرکز هماهنگ مقیاسپذیری ایجاد کند اما تاکنون هیچ پلتفرمی روی کار نیامده تا بتواند به هر دو نیاز با حفظ امنیت پاسخ دهد. هارمونی به دنبال چنین هدفی است.
همانگونه گوگل عمودی پلتفرم جستوجوی خود را کامل کرد، ما نیز از یک رویکرد استک برای حل مشکل مقیاسپذیری اجماع استفاده خواهیم کرد.
ما در هر لایه از الگوریتمهای اجماع، سیستمها و شبکهسازی نوآوریهایی اعمال کردیم تا با حفظ غیرمتمرکزسازی، کارایی شبکهمان را به حداکثر برسانیم. یکپارچهسازی ما از نوع انتها به انتها (End to End) بوده و این به ما امکان میدهد تا تکرارهای سریعتر و بهینهسازی فعالتری نسبت به متدهای ماژولار داشته باشیم.
پرسشهایی که به درک بهتر پلتفرم هارمونی کمک میکنند
هارمونی چیست؟
هارمونی یک زیرساخت با مقیاسپذیری ۱ تا ۱۰ میلیارد نفر برای آینده است. هارمونی یک پلتفرم اجماع با کارایی بالا ایجاد کرده که اقتصاد غیرمتمرکز را برای همهی افراد فراهم میکند.
هارمونی با بلاک چین عمومی چه تفاوتی دارد؟
هارمونی برخلاف رقبایش تنها بر روی کارایی توان عملیاتی (تعداد تراکنش در هر ثانیه) متمرکز نیست، بلکه به تعداد نودهایی که در شبکهی بلاک چینی غیرمتمرکز شرکت میکنند نیز اهمیت میدهد.
هارمونی برای حل مشکل مقیاسپذیری چه کار میکند؟
در لایهی پروتکل، از پروتکل اجماع مبتنی بر شاردینگ استفاده میکند که امکان افزایش نودها را در شبکه فراهم میآورد. هر شارد شامل صدها نود بوده و از یک الگوریتم BFT برای برقراری اجماع در چند ثانیه استفاده میشود.
در لایهی شبکه، از پروتکل QUIC برای انتقال سریعتر پیامها و در سطح سیستم از unikernel برای مقیاسپذیری بیشتر سیستمعامل در یک نود استفادهشده است.
با پلتفرم هارمونی چه میتوان ساخت؟
برنامههای کاربردی متنوعی که نیاز به غیرمتمرکزسازی و شبکهای با توان عملیاتی بالا دارند از بازیها گرفته تا مبادلات غیرمتمرکز و بازارهای مبتنی بر هوش مصنوعی میتوانند بر بستر هارمونی توسعه پیدا کنند.
چهزمانی تمام افراد میتوانند از پلتفرم هارمونی استفاده کنند؟
بنیانگذاران هارمونی بسیار مشتاقاند تا برنامهنویسان و ایده پردازان، برنامههای کاربردی خود را بر بستر هارمونی توسعه دهند و شبکهی اصلی تا سال ۲۰۱۹ راهاندازی خواهد شد.
منبع:harmony